What Is Acid Washing and When Is It Required?
Acid washing, an essential aspect of pool maintenance, is a method where a solution of water and muriatic acid is applied to eliminate stubborn stains and algae growth. This isn't a regular maintenance task; however, it is required when your pool's surface becomes dull or gets stained despite routine cleaning. Knowing when to perform an acid wash can significantly improve your pool's lifespan and keep its attractive look.
A Guide to Acid Treatment
While you may not know about acid washing is a crucial procedure in pool maintenance that becomes necessary under certain circumstances. This process involves using a mixture of water and muriatic acid to clean off the top layer of a pool's surface. The various acid wash methods applied are primarily determined by the pool surface types, whether plaster, fiberglass, or vinyl.
The acid washing process removes persistent stains, algae growth, and mineral deposits, restoring the pool's pristine look and brilliance. This process also reveals any hidden damage or deterioration that might impact your pool's structural integrity or performance. Although it's a potent solution, acid washing needs to be used sparingly, as overuse may harm the pool finish.
Evaluating Acid Wash Need
Now that you're familiar with the acid washing process and its importance in pool maintenance, it's crucial to understand when this procedure is necessary. Common indicators for acid washing are staining in your pool due to mineral deposits, algae growth, or stains from debris.
If you notice your pool has lost its luster or has noticeable staining, these are clear indicators that it needs acid here washing. A dull, uninviting look, even with routine cleaning and balanced chemicals, points to the requirement for intensive cleaning. Keep in mind acid washing isn't a regular maintenance task but a remedial treatment. Key Safety Measures for Acid Washing
Although acid washing significantly enhances the appearance and health of your pool, it's important to focus on safety during the process. Protective equipment, including safety goggles, gloves, and respiratory protection, is required to guard you from dangerous chemical exposure. Don't underestimate the significance of proper chemical handling. Make sure to add acid to water, never the reverse, to avoid dangerous chemical reactions. Carefully follow the manufacturer's directions and verify the area is well-ventilated. Keeping acid away from skin with the acid is essential. If an accident takes place, rinse with plenty of water and get medical help right away. Keep in mind safety should never be compromised. Acid washing is a detailed process, but with correct safety measures, you can rejuvenate your pool's appearance successfully.
